**Danielle Giddings Fontenot, Esq.** *Divorce & Separation Attorney* *Law Offices of Paul Lenkowsky* *Bullhead City, AZ* Danielle Giddings Fontenot is a dedicated attorney specializing in divorce and family law at the Law Offices of Paul Lenkowsky in Bullhead City, Arizona. Born in Santa Clarita, California, on September 6, 1976, Danielle has made a significant impact in the legal community since her admission to the Arizona Bar in 2017. She earned her Juris Doctor from Arizona Summit Law School in 2015, building a strong foundation for her legal career. Prior to this achievement, Danielle received a Bachelor of Science in Public Management from Northern Arizona University in 2012 and an Associate of Arts in Paralegal Studies from Mohave Community College in 2011. This diverse educational background equips her with a unique perspective on the complexities of family law and civil litigation. As a member of the State Bar of Arizona and the Mohave County Bar Association, Danielle is committed to upholding the highest standards of the legal profession. Her practice areas extend beyond divorce and domestic relations law to include civil litigation and criminal defense, ensuring comprehensive support for her clients during challenging times. About Divorce & Separation Law

Divorce attorneys guide couples through the legal process of ending their marriage. They handle property division, custody, support, and other divorce-related matters. Common matters include contested divorce, uncontested divorce, property division, alimony.
